The Kenya Certificate of Secondary Education (KCSE) examination enters its final week this week, and students are expected to write their final tests on Friday, November 22, 2024.

This year’s exams are being held in 10,755 centres, with the largest number of candidates ever recorded—965,501 students, up from 903,138 in 2023.

KCSE 2024 officially began on October 22 when the candidates took their oral and practical exams for elective subjects like French, German, and Music, months after those taking technical subjects such as Art and Design, Woodwork, and Metalwork had already begun their projects.

The general exam period for common subjects like Mathematics, English, and Chemistry began on Monday, November 11, and the candidates will finish with the Physics Practical this Friday in one session that will take two hours and 30 minutes, from 8:00 AM to 10:30 AM.
